In my case Reaper generally records input midi timing fine and syncs playback midi timing fine against playback audio timing.

Similarly I cam playback a reaper midi track into a hardware synth and record the synth to reaper audio track and both tracks sync fine against each other on playback.

I slightlu adjusted reaper record/playback offsets to put it "right on the money" but was within a couple of ms with default automatic settings.

The pronlem is hardware midi playthru timing because reaper only transmits hardware midi playthru at AUDIO BUFFER BOUNDARIES. A long ago software design decision.

I do not use any midi plugins in reaper, not even channel mapping and program change plugin. All my jsfx are audio plugins.

The midi thru workaround is strictly "always hardwired" rather than midi interface patching/merging.

KX88 midi out to a spare GM syntj input (old roland DS330). DS330 mIdi thru to midi express input 1 into the computer. So when I record a midi track I listen to un-delayed scratch audio from DS330 rather than the messed up timing coming out of reaper hardware midi thru.

After reaper records midi, hardware midi playback timing seems OK. So far as I can tell, the main thing messed up is hardware midi playthru timing.

A main reason I prefer hardware which many think is an idiotic attitude-- The hardware will always have the same specs and performance until it wears out. No guarantee how long before it wears out but in my experience it is usually a long time. Seems to me bonkers to buy hardware that is computer-dependent for basic operation. At any time Windows or MacOS can have "one more update" that kills the controlling software, rendering such hardware useless except as a doorstop. I don't want hardware held hostage to the whims of Apple or Microsoft. Don't tell me it can't happen, I've seen it again and again over the years. :) Am not talking about computer peripherals, which are necessarily dependent on vagarities of computer OS and support software. Talking about synths, amps, speakers, standalone signal processors, etc.

My favorite routing/mapping/merging midi interfaces were motu Midi Time Piece II and Midi Time Piece AV. Virtually all functions front-panel programmable. None of the routing/mapping/merging was computer dependent. My old MTPII still works good as new. Though it has been un-usable as a MIDI interface since apple quit making computers with ADB ports (decades), MTPII still works fab as a standalone 8X8 router/mapper/merger. I do not understand why motu quit making that class of interface.

My motu midi experss 128 8X8 is not programmable at all, just a dumb 8X8 interface, but is not very expensive. If I needed extensive routing/mapping/merging I would re-rack the MTPII right above the Midi Express 128 in the rack, and get a bunch of 18" midi patch cables. Cross-wire all the Midi Express ins/outs with the MTPII ins/outs. Thereby adding front panel-programmable routing/mapping/merge to the 8 port dumb midi interface capability.

For many years when I was programming for a living had to test/debug lots of consumer audio/midi interfaces, so I would hook up the 1 or 2 midi i/o on cheap/midprice interfaces to the first 1 or 2 inputs/outputs of the MTPII, enabling 1 or 2 computer ports to transmit/receive with a stack of synths via the MTPII.

I also have an old 360 Systems midi patcher which presumably still works, but haven't had a midi rig big enough to need it since the 1990's. Back then used the MTPII hooked up along with the 360 systems to access all the synths.

Yes an unbuffered mechanical switch network might be viable for some uses. Care would be needed to minimize odds of ground loops (isolated ground jacks, switching both wires in each MIDI pair, break before make switches, etc). A series of toggles might do. I would have thought maybe multi-stack rotary switches but perhaps the simpler/cruder the better. A few years ago noticed that custom-configured stacked rotary switches can now be ordered in small quantities from China. Probably such custom parts would raise the parts cost higher than some sort of mass-market MIDI patcher. Alas long ago there was bigger variety of MIDI patcher gear.

My current simple use of the motu Midi Express 128 connects 88 key controller to InPort 1, no OutPort 1 connection since it is a controller-only. And nothing is connected to InPorts 2 thru 8. OutPorts 2 thru 8 are connected to various noise boxes.

If worth the trouble (possibly some day), I could re-mount the old MTPII above the Midi Express 128 and cross-wire thusly:
KX88Out -> MTPII In_1
MTPII Out_1 -> Midi Express In_1
Midi Express Outs 2 thru 8 -> MTPII Inputs 2 thru 8
MTPII Outputs 2 thru 8 -> Hardware synths

Then I could front-panel program the MTPII to send KX88 output to the computer and also direct to any assortment of synths, each output port on a different Midi channel if desired. And any synth I want played by the computer, I could program the MTPII to echo its numbered Midi Input (from the Midi Express 128) to its Midi Output. It could also be programmed to Merge, sending both computer Midii output and KX88 to a destination synth. Unless I'm having a senior moment and thinking about it all wrong.

The merge trick would be most practical if the computer is sending on different MIDI channels than the KX88 to avoid trainwrecks. But the MTPII easily maps channels, and that would be the typical desired sequencer operation. For example if using a multitimbral synth to play a bunch of horn parts on different Midi channels-- Play the "already-recorded" horn parts from the computer on their assigned channels, and record the new horn part on a new Midi channel, also monitoring it merged "direct live" from the keyboard controller.

Perhaps my previous goal of getting every function into one convenient workspace was wrongheaded. But I thought being able to monitor synth tones "as flat and clear possible" while tracking was purt important. A possible alternative :

Set up two rooms (or one big room, but my house doesn't have any real big rooms).

_1_ A Mixing/Mastering room with only the monitor speakers, computer and vid monitors, and several fathoms of fluffy fiberglass acoustic treatment. The only design considerations would be acoustics and easy access to lots of screen real estate.

_2_ A tracking room possibly only lightly acoustic treated unless live micing will be common. With one or more keyboard stacks, however many needed, plus whatever guitar/bass/drum/singing stations desired. Sound system just a high quality stereo PA, midfield or farfield monitoring depending on room size. Room acoustics not so important so long as the speakers have decent fidelity and most recording is "direct". Because most final mixing EQ would happen in the Mix/Mastering room, PERHAPS the tracks laid here only need to be clean and "close enough that it can be polished in the Mixing stage".

That way tracking room ergonomics could be refined without having to worry about the room acoustics impact of the equipment.
